sanebeyondone wrote:
Of the 45 households in a certain neighborhood, 28 subscribe to Newspaper Q, 17 subscribe to Newspaper R, 12 subscribe to Newspaper S, 7 subscribe to both Q and R, 8 subscribe to both Q and S, and 9 subscribe to both R and S. The number of households who subscribe to all three newspapers is equal to the number of households who subscribe to none of the three newspapers. If 39 of the households subscribe to at least one of the three newspapers, how many households subscribe to only one of the newspapers?

A) 15
B) 21
C) 27
D) 33
E) 46

I think wording of this problem is a bit unclear

For example,
7 subscribe to both Q and R

Does this mean
7 subscribe to ONLY both Q and R (exclusive)
OR
7 subscribe to NOT only both Q and R and to something else. (nonexclusive)


Though somehow I know it right the way for example,
28 subscribe to Newspaper Q
That means nonexclusive.

Posted from my mobile device


The statement '7 subscribe to both Q and R' means exactly that – 7 households subscribe to both, without implying exclusivity. For instance, when the stem states '28 subscribe to Newspaper Q', it's understood that these 28 households are subscribers of Q, yet some may also be subscribed to other newspapers. In a similar vein, '7 subscribe to both Q and R' suggests that these 7 households subscribe to Q and R, but it does not exclude the possibility of them also being subscribed to S.

Furthermore, as this is an official question, the wording is as good as it gets.

yrozenblum wrote:
Of the 45 households in a certain neighborhood, 28 subscribe to Newspaper Q, 17 subscribe to Newspaper R, 12 subscribe to Newspaper S, 7 subscribe to both Q and R, 8 subscribe to both Q and S, and 9 subscribe to both R and S. The number of households who subscribe to all three newspapers is equal to the number of households who subscribe to none of the three newspapers. If 39 of the households subscribe to at least one of the three newspapers, how many households subscribe to only one of the newspapers?

A) 15
B) 21
C) 27
D) 33
E) 46


7 subscribe to both Q and R : x+y=7
8 subscribe to both Q and S : y+z=8
9 subscribe to both R and S : w+y=9

If 39 of the households subscribe to at least one of the three newspapers then 6 households subscribe to none of them
The number of households who subscribe to all three newspapers is equal to the number of households who subscribe to none of the three newspapers
y=6
x=1 ; z=2 ; w= 3
households who subscribe to only Q : 28-x-y-z =19
households who subscribe to only R : 17-w-y-x =7
households who subscribe to only S : 12-z-y-w =1

Number of households that subscribe to only one of the newspapers is 19+7+1=27
